ABHISHEK REDDY ORAL ORDER 22-08-2023 This matter was called on 12.07.2023 and 09.08.2023 and has been specifically posted under the caption 'For Orders' as there was no representation on behalf of learned counsel for petitioner.

Even today, there is no representation on behalf of

Patna High Court CWJC No.13900 of 2015(5) dt.22-08-2023 2/2 learned counsel for the petitioner. It appears that the petitioner is not interested in prosecuting the present writ petition. Having regard to the same, the matter is dismissed for default.
